"Reverse Work" vs. "Turn Work" TATTING tutorial

I think this can be a confusing concept for beginner tatters. So I tried to simplify the concepts for you visually.
This example is tatted in the traditional way.

Reverse Work "RW" means to flip from top to bottom.

Turn Work "TW" means to turn like a page in a book...from right to left.

Notice how the chain turned directions. I use a lot of TW's in my patterns.

Here's a bonus picture showing a "floating ring". If Orange is Shuttle #1 and green is shuttle #2 (in lieu of ball thread), you can use shuttle #2 to throw off rings.
